Concept of Strategic Management

The term Strategic Management is made up of two words: Strategy and Management.

Meaning of Strategy

A strategy is a carefully designed long-term plan or course of action that helps an organization to achieve its goals and gain an advantage over competitors. It provides direction for making important decisions and also guides the organization to respond with changes in its internal and external environment.

In simple terms, strategy is the roadmap that guides an organization towards its long-term goals.

Meaning of Management

Management is the process of planning, organizing, leading, and controlling an organization’s resources—such as people, finance, materials, and technology—to achieve predetermined objectives efficiently and effectively.

In simple terms, management is the process of getting work done through people and available resources to accomplish organizational goals.

When these two concepts are combined, strategic management refers to the process of planning and managing an organization’s long-term direction by making and implementing strategies that help to achieve the organizational mission and objectives.

Simple Definition: Strategic management is the process of planning, implementing, and evaluating strategies to achieve an organization’s long-term goals.

Detailed Definition: Strategic management is a continuous process through which an organization analyzes its internal and external environment, formulates strategies, implements them effectively, and evaluates their performance to achieve their sustainable long-term objectives and gain competitive advantage.

Definitions by Scholars

  1. According to Lloyd L. Byars, “Strategic management is concerned with making decisions about an organization’s future direction and implementing those decisions.”
